1.Skin-to-epidural distance in the Southeast Asian paediatric population: multiethnic morphometrics and international comparisons.
Jolin WONG ; Serene Siu Tin LIM
Singapore medical journal 2019;60(3):136-139
INTRODUCTION:
Paediatric epidurals can present technical challenges due to wide variations in age and weight among children, ranging from neonates to teenagers. This study evaluated the skin-to-epidural distance in the thoracic and lumbar regions to determine the relationship between age, weight and ethnicity and depth to the epidural space in our Singapore paediatric population.
METHODS:
Data from the Acute Pain Service was prospectively collected over 16 years. Details included patient demographics, level of epidural performed and distance from skin to epidural space. Multivariable regression analysis was performed to determine the association of weight, age, ethnicity and gender with the depths to the thoracic and lumbar epidural spaces. A simple linear regression was calculated to predict the depth to both thoracic and lumbar epidural spaces based on body weight. Equations were formulated to describe the relationship between weight and depth of epidural space.
RESULTS:
A total of 616 midline epidurals were studied. Regression analysis was performed for 225 thoracic epidurals and 363 lumbar epidurals. Our study revealed a clear correlation between skin-to-lumbar epidural distance and weight in children. The best correlation was demonstrated between skin-to-lumbar epidural distance and body weight (R = 0.729). This relationship was described by the formula: depth (mm) = (0.63 × weight [kg]) + 9.2.
CONCLUSION
Skin-to-lumbar epidural distance correlated with weight in children. Our results highlighted the clinical significance of differences between Southeast Asian paediatric populations when compared to other populations.

2.Rise of the Visible Monkey: Sectioned Images of Rhesus Monkey
Beom Sun CHUNG ; Chang Yeop JEON ; Jae Won HUH ; Kang Jin JEONG ; Donghwan HAR ; Kyu Sung KWACK ; Jin Seo PARK
Journal of Korean Medical Science 2019;34(8):e66-
BACKGROUND: Gross anatomy and sectional anatomy of a monkey should be known by students and researchers of veterinary medicine and medical research. However, materials to learn the anatomy of a monkey are scarce. Thus, the objective of this study was to produce a Visible Monkey data set containing cross sectional images, computed tomographs (CTs), and magnetic resonance images (MRIs) of a monkey whole body. METHODS: Before and after sacrifice, a female rhesus monkey was used for 3 Tesla MRI and CT scanning. The monkey was frozen and sectioned at 0.05 mm intervals for the head region and at 0.5 mm intervals for the rest of the body using a cryomacrotome. Each sectioned surface was photographed using a digital camera to obtain horizontal sectioned images. Segmentation of sectioned images was performed to elaborate three-dimensional (3D) models of the skin and brain. RESULTS: A total of 1,612 horizontal sectioned images of the head and 1,355 images of the remaining region were obtained. The small pixel size (0.024 mm × 0.024 mm) and real color (48 bits color) of these images enabled observations of minute structures. CONCLUSION: Due to small intervals of these images, continuous structures could be traced completely. Moreover, 3D models of the skin and brain could be used for virtual dissections. Sectioned images of this study will enhance the understanding of monkey anatomy and foster further studies. These images will be provided to any requesting researcher free of charge.

3.Effects of different moxibustion temperature on cholesterol and skin around "Shenque" (CV 8) in mice with hyperlipidemia.
Guiying WANG ; Yaoshuai WANG ; Kaixin LU ; Li ZHONG ; Lingling WANG
Chinese Acupuncture & Moxibustion 2016;36(1):59-63
OBJECTIVETo observe the effects of moxibustion with different temperatures on cholesterol and skin around "Shenque" (CV 8) in mice with acute hyperlipidemia, and to explore the correlation between moxibustion effect and transient receptor potential vanilloid 1 (TRPV1).
METHODSEight mice among 32 mice of C57BL/6J wild type (WT) were selected into a blank group, and the remaining 24 mice were made into the acute hyperlipidemia model by injection of egg yolk. After model establishment, the mice were randomly divided into a model group, a 38 °C moxibustion group and a 46 °C moxibustion group, 8 mice in each group. The temperature was (38 ± 1) °C in the 38 °C moxibustion group and (46 ± 1) °C in the 46 °C moxibustion group. "Shenque" (CV 8) and "Zusanli" (ST 36) were selected in the two groups; moxibustion was given for 10 min per time, once a day for 2 times. Mice in the blank group and model group were treated with immobilization and moxibustion was not given. After treatment, the level of serum cholesterol was tested by oxidase method; the morphology of skin around "Shenque" (CV 8) was observed by HE staining; the expression of TRPV1 in skin was measured by immunohistochemistry.
RESULTS(1) Compared with the blank group, the level of serum cholesterol was increased in the model group (P < 0.001); compared with the model group, the level of serum cholesterol was reduced in the 46 °C moxibustion group (P < 0.001); compared with the 38 °C moxibustion group, the level of serum cholesterol was reduced in the 46 °C moxibustion group (P < 0.01). (2) There was slight change of morphology and structure in skin tissue in the 38 °C moxibustion group, while obvious change was observed in the 46 °C moxibustion group, indicating specific change. (3) The difference of the expression of TRPV1 in skin was significantly different between 46 °C moxibustion group and blank group, model group (both P < 0.01); it was also different from the 38 °C moxibustion group (P < 0.05).
CONCLUSIONMoxibustion temperature is one of the important factors affecting the cholesterol and acupoint skin. The effects of moxibustion are related to TRPV1.

4.Clinical experience of penile elongation: a comparison of four different operative approaches.
Song YONGSHENG ; Yu QINGPING ; Jiang YIYANG ; He WENYOU ; Li JIGEN ; He XIAOHAI ; He JINTAO ; Zhou YIDONG ; Wang HANFENG ; Zhou XIAOWEI ; Wang ZUAN
Chinese Journal of Plastic Surgery 2015;31(6):411-413
OBJECTIVETo investigate the curative effect of penile elongation with four differentoperative approaches.
METHODSThrough four different operative approaches (the coronary sulcus ringincision, Y or Z shaped incision or Z shaped incision combined with coronary sulcus ring incision), thepenile skin and fascia were degloved until the penile root. Then the superficial and deep dorsal penilesuspensory ligament were cut off. After electric coagulation of the residue ends, the two-side tissue at thefront of the pubic symphysis was sutured. Then the penile skin and fascia were repositioned and the incisionat the inner and outer plate was closed.
RESULTSThe increased penile static length was (2.9 ± 0.2) cmwith abdominal wall Y incision (12 cases); (3.1 ± 0.3) cm with transabdominal modified Z incision (260 cases); (3.9 ± 0.7) cm with coronary sulcus ring incision (363 cases); (3.4 ± 0.8) cm with combined incision (39 cases). The lengthening effect was significantly different between the coronary ring incision and abdominal wall Y/Z incision (P < 0.05). The postoperative follow-up period was 6 months to 5.5 years without serious complications. Only 3 cases of subcutaneous hematoma occurred with treatment of debridement and drainage. 4 cases with ischemic necrosis at distal penile skin, were treated with debridement, dressing and physiotherapy, leaving no scar.
CONCLUSIONSPenile lengthening surgery are safe and effective through different approaches. The coronal ring incision has the best therapeutic effect.

5.Horn shaped perforator flap pedicled with the angular artery: anatomy basis and clinical application.
Ma DAMENG ; Li XIAOJING ; Ning JINLONG ; Ding MAOCHAO ; Li XINYI ; Yao WENDE ; Chen ZHAO ; Ge LIZHENG
Chinese Journal of Plastic Surgery 2015;31(4):241-245
OBJECTIVETo explore the anatomic basis and clinical application of the horn shaped perforator flap pedicled with the angular artery for the reconstruction of midface defect.
METHODS(1) 10 fresh cadavers were perfused with a modified guiding oxide gelatin mixture for three-dimensional visualization reconstruction using a 16-slice spiral computed tomography scanner and specialized software (Materiaise' s interactive medical image control system, MIMICS). The origin and distribution of the angular artery perforator were observed. (2) Between July 2012 and July 2014, twenty-one patients underwent operations for the reconstruction of midface defect. Ten patients had squamous cell carcinoma, nine patients had basal cell carcinoma and two patients had nevus. The flaps' size ranged from 1.5 cm x 3.5 cm to 2.5 cm x 5.0 cm.
RESULTSThe facial artery branches the lateral nasal artery 1 cm from the outside corner of the mouth, subsequently strenches to inner canthus continuing as the angular artery. The angular artery anastomoses extensively with the dorsal nasal artery and the infraorbital artery. All the flaps survived. The patients were satisfied with the final aesthetic and functional results.
CONCLUSIONSThe flap can be designed flexibly and simply with reliable blood supply. The donor sites could be closed directly without skin graft, it is a simple and fast method for the reconstruction of midface defect.

6.The anatomy and clinical application of reverse saphenous nerve neurocutaneous flaps for reparing skin defects of forefoot.
Haijiao MAO ; Zengyuan SHI ; Weigang YIN ; Dachuan XU ; Zhenxin LIU
Chinese Journal of Plastic Surgery 2015;31(1):25-29
OBJECTIVETo investigate the effect of reverse saphenous nerve neurocutaneous flaps for skin defects of forefoot.
METHODSIn the anatomic study, 50 cadaveric feet were injected with red latex and the anastomosis, distribution and external diameters of medialtarsal artery, medial anterior malleolus artery, medial plantar artery, the superficial branch of the medial basal hallucal artery and saphenousnerve nutritional vessels were observed. Based on anatomic research results, we designed the reverse saphenous nerve neurocutaneous flaps for repairing skin defects of forefoot.
RESULTSThe blood supply of reverse saphenous nerve neurocutaneous flaps were based on the vasoganglion, which consist of arterial arch at the superior border of abductor hallucis and arterial network on the surface of abductor hallucis around the saphenous nerve and medial pedis flap. From Oct. 2006 to Oct. 2011, the reverse saphenous nerve neurocutaneous flaps were used to repair skin defects of forefoot in 11 cases. The flap size ranged from 2.5 cm x 3.5 cm to 7.5 cm x 8.5 cm. The wounds at donor site were covered with full-thickness skin graft. All flaps survived completely with no ulcer at the donor site. 11 cases were followed up for 6 to 18 months( mean, 10 months). The skin color and texture were satisfactory. The patients could walk very well.
CONCLUSIONSIt is reliable to repair the skin defects of forefoot with reverse saphenous nerve neurocutaneous flaps. It is easily performed with less morbidity. This flap should be considered as a preferential way to reconstruct skin defects of forefoot.

7.Relationship between allergic factors and eosinophilic nasal polyps.
Guimin ZHANG ; Jinmei ZHANG ; Wenjie SHI ; Peiyong SUN ; Peng LIN
Journal of Clinical Otorhinolaryngology Head and Neck Surgery 2015;29(12):1098-1100
OBJECTIVE:
To explore the effects of allergic factores in eosinophilic nasal polyps.
METHOD:
Clinical characters of 67 eosinophilic nasal polyps patients and 26 lymphocyte nasal polyps patients were restrospeetively analyzed. Allergic factors, allergens and nasal anatomic variations were compared between two groups.
RESULT:
Allergic factors are proned to present in eosinophilic nasal polyps group compared with lymphocyte nasal polyps group; The positive rates of allergen skin test between eosinophilic nasal polyps group and lymphocyte nasal polyps group showed significant difference; Allergens in eosinophilic nasal polyps group are different from lymphocyte nasal polyps group; Nasal anatomic variations are different between two groups.
CONCLUSION
Different pathogenesis maybe exist in different pathological type nasal polyps. Allergic factors are closely relative to eosinophilic nasal polyps and nasal anatomic variations play a more important role in the formation of lymhocyte nasal polyps.

8.Effect of microneedle combined with Lauromacrogol on skin capillary network: experimental study.
Sida XU ; Qiang WEI ; Youfen FAN ; Shihai CHEN ; Qingfeng LIU ; Guoqiang YIN ; Mingde LIAO ; Yu SUN
Chinese Journal of Plastic Surgery 2014;30(6):448-451
OBJECTIVETo explore the effect of microneedle combined with Lauromacrogol on skin capillary network.
METHODS24 male Leghone (1.5-2.0 kg in weight) were randomly divided into three groups as group A (microneedle combined with Lauromacrogol), B (microneedle combined with physiological saline) , and C(control). The cockscombs were treated. The specimens were taken on the 7th, 14th, 21th , and 28th day postoperatively. HE staining, immunohistochemical staining and special staining were performed for study of the number of capillary and collagen I/III , as well as elastic fibers.
RESULTSThe color of cockscombs in group A became lightening after treatment. The number of capillary decreased as showing by HE staining. The collagen I and III in group B was significantly different from that in group A and C (P < 0.05). Special staining showed proliferation of elastic fibers in group B.
CONCLUSIONSIt indicates that microneedle combined with Lauromacrogol could effectively reduce the capillary in cockscomb without any tissue fibrosis. Microneedle can stimulate the proliferation of elastic fiber, so as to improve the skin ageing process.

9.Rapid quantification of total nitrogen and end-point determination of hide melting in manufacturing of donkey-hide gelatin.
Hai-Fan HAN ; Lu ZHANG ; Yan ZHANG ; Wen-Long LI ; Hai-Bin QU
China Journal of Chinese Materia Medica 2014;39(6):1043-1047
Hide melting presents itself as one of the most critical processes in the production of donkey-hide gelatin. Here a NIR-based method was established for the rapid analysis of in-process hide melting solutions as well as for end-point determination of this process. Near infrared (NIR) spectra of hide melting solutions were collected in transflective mode. With the contents of total nitrogen determined by the Kjeldahl method as reference values, partial least squares regression (PLSR) was employed to build calibration models between NIR spectra and total nitrogen. Model parameters including wavelength range and PLS factors were optimized to achieve best model performance. Based on the contents of total nitrogen predicted by calibration model, end point of hide melting was determined. The constructed PLS model gave a high correlation coefficient (R2) of 0.991 3 and a root mean square error of prediction (RMSEP) of 0.807 g x L(-1). With the predicted total nitrogen and predefined limit, decisions concerning the proper times of melting were made. This research demonstrated that NIR transflectance spectroscopy could be used to expeditiously determine the contents of total nitrogen which was subsequently chosen as the indictor for determining the end-point of hide melting. The proposed procedure may help avoid unnecessary raw material or energy consumption.

10.Perianal Tick-Bite Lesion Caused by a Fully Engorged Female Amblyomma testudinarium.
Jin KIM ; Haeng An KANG ; Sung Sun KIM ; Hyun Soo JOO ; Won Seog CHONG
The Korean Journal of Parasitology 2014;52(6):685-690
A perianal tick and the surrounding skin were surgically excised from a 73-year-old man residing in a southwestern costal area of the Korean Peninsula. Microscopically a deep penetrating lesion was formed beneath the attachment site. Dense and mixed inflammatory cell infiltrations occurred in the dermis and subcutaneous tissues around the feeding lesion. Amorphous eosinophilic cement was abundant in the center of the lesion. The tick had Y-shaped anal groove, long mouthparts, ornate scutum, comma-shaped spiracular plate, distinct eyes, and fastoons. It was morphologically identified as a fully engorged female Amblyomma testudinarium. This is the third human case of Amblyomma tick infection in Korea.
